Vseslav of Polotsk or Vseslav Bryachislavich, also known as Vseslav the Sorcerer or Vseslav the Seer (c. 1039 1101), was the most famous ruler of Polotsk and was briefly Grand Prince of Kiev in 1068 1069. Polotsk's Cathedral of Holy Wisdom (completed in 1066) is one of the most enduring monuments on the lands of modern Belarus and dates to his 57-year reign.The reverse of a 20 ruble Belarusian silver commemorative coin issued in 2005 with Vseslav ("Usiaslau") of Polotsk and a depiction of him as a werewolf in the background. Vselav was the son of Bryachislav Izyaslavich, Prince of Polotsk and Vitebsk, and was thus the great-grandson of Vladimir I of Kiev and Rogneda of Polotsk. He was born in ca. 1030 1039 in Polotsk (with Vasilii as his baptismal name) and married around 1060.
